I suspect part of the problem is that the author is fighting the system prompt, which gives Claude instructions to help it avoid filling up its context window. So the author thinks he's giving Claude this instruction: > You must re-read CLAUDE2.md, even if you've already read it before. But the actual instruction is closer to: > Do not re-read files you have already read. You must re-read CLAUDE2.md, even if you've already read it before. So Claude has conflicting instructions. Is it any surprise that it tries to thread the needle by re-reading the minimal amount of CLAUDE2.md necessary? It's just doing its best to satisfy both masters! | ||
